(10Z)-4H,5H,6H,7H,8H,9H-Cyclo-deca-[d][1,2,3]selena-diazole
Dieter Schollmeyer1, Heiner Detert1
1University of Mainz, Department of Chemistry, Duesbergweg 10-14, 55099 Mainz, Germany.
Abstract:
The title compound, C10H14N2Se, was prepared from a semicarbazone and selenium dioxide. The planes of the heterocycle and the cis double bond are almost mutually orthogonal and the hexa-methyl-ene tether is nearly strain-free.
